How to zoom in on Canva

How to zoom in on Canva

How to zoom in on Canva

This guide provides a comprehensive walkthrough on zooming into an image using Canva. It includes straightforward steps to help you effectively manage the zoom feature, ensuring a smooth and user-friendly experience.

Method 1

Begin by opening the image you wish to zoom in on within Canva. Click directly on the image to select it. To start zooming, press "Ctrl" and "+" on your keyboard simultaneously to zoom in on the image.


Method 2

Alternatively, you can also use the slider located below the image to either zoom in or zoom out as needed.

This feature is particularly helpful for achieving the desired focus and detail.

Pro tips to zoom in on Canva

  1. Use the Zoom Slider:
    In the bottom-left corner of the Canva editor, you’ll find a zoom slider. Drag it to zoom in or out on your image for more precise adjustments and editing.

  2. Zoom Using the Mouse:
    Hold down the Ctrl (Windows) or Command (Mac) key on your keyboard and scroll your mouse wheel up or down to zoom in or out.

  3. Zoom In for Detail Editing:
    To fine-tune elements in your image, zoom in by using the slider or mouse. This will allow you to make more accurate edits like cropping or adjusting specific parts of the image.

  4. Zoom Out for Overview:
    When working on larger designs or adjusting multiple elements, zoom out using the zoom slider to get a better overview of your entire design.

  5. Fit to Screen:
    To quickly reset the zoom to fit the entire design on the screen, click the “Fit” option in the zoom slider.

Common pitfalls and how to avoid them while zoom in on Canva

  1. Losing Detail in Zoomed-In Images:
    Fix: When zooming in, ensure that you’re not losing context of your design. Zoom in gradually and check the image from different zoom levels to avoid missing important details.

  2. Zooming Out Too Much:
    Fix: Zoom out too much and you may lose track of individual design elements. Regularly zoom back in to ensure precise positioning of your elements.

  3. Blurry Images After Zooming:
    Fix: If your image becomes blurry after zooming, ensure that the image is high-resolution to avoid pixelation. Canva may blur low-resolution images when zoomed in.

  4. Accidentally Moving Elements While Zooming:
    Fix: When zooming in or out, avoid dragging elements unintentionally. Lock elements you’re not working with to prevent accidental movements.

  5. Not Resetting Zoom to Default:
    Fix: If you zoom in too much and can’t see the full canvas, use the “Fit” option in the zoom slider to reset the zoom and regain a full view of your design.

Common FAQs for zooming on an image in Canva

  1. How do I zoom in on a specific part of an image?
    You can zoom in on an image by selecting the image, then using the zoom slider or keyboard shortcuts to focus on the desired area.

  2. Can I zoom out to see the entire design in Canva?
    Yes, use the zoom slider to zoom out, or click the "Fit" button to view your entire design.

  3. Does zooming affect the quality of my image?
    Zooming in on your image within Canva doesn’t affect the quality. However, zooming into low-resolution images can make them appear pixelated.

  4. Can I adjust the zoom level for the entire design?
    Yes, you can zoom in or out on the entire canvas using the zoom slider to adjust the zoom for your entire design.

  5. Can I zoom using my touchpad?
    Yes, on most laptops, you can zoom in and out using the touchpad by pinching in or out with two fingers.
